Why Fractional CFO Costs Vary as Much as They Do 

There is no single price for fractional CFO services because there is no single version of the engagement. The cost is shaped by scope of work and hours per month. A business that needs a senior financial presence two days a month will pay less than one that needs five. A CFO brought in to build a full financial infrastructure from scratch is doing significantly more than one engaged for a focused advisory role. 

Engagement model also plays a role. Part-time, outsourced, and virtual CFO arrangements each carry different cost structures that reflect the nature of the work rather than the quality of it. Experience matters too. A fractional CFO with deep knowledge of your specific industry, whether manufacturing, professional services, transportation, or engineering, typically delivers faster, more targeted results and commands a rate that reflects that. 


Fractional CFO Cost vs Full-Time CFO Cost

The most useful way to think about fractional CFO costs is not as a standalone number but as a comparison to the alternative. 

A full-time CFO in Canada carries a significant base salary, benefits, bonuses, and the overhead of a permanent executive hire. For most growth-stage businesses, that level of financial commitment is not justified by the actual volume of strategic financial work the business needs done on a daily basis. 

A fractional CFO delivers the same calibre of financial leadership at a fraction of that cost, precisely because the engagement is scoped to what the business actually needs. You are not paying for a full executive salary when the work genuinely requires two or three days of senior financial attention per month. 

For growing businesses that have recognized the warning signs, whether that is unpredictable cash flow, decisions being made without reliable data, or a lender conversation on the horizon, the cost of a fractional CFO is almost always significantly lower than the cost of continuing without proper financial leadership. What’s Included in Fractional CFO Costs

Understanding what drives fractional CFO costs also means understanding what a well-structured engagement actually delivers. This is not a reporting service or a compliance function. It is strategic financial leadership. 

A comprehensive fractional CFO engagement typically includes: 

  • Strategic financial planning: Building the forward-looking financial framework that connects day-to-day financial decisions to long-term business goals 
  • Cash flow management: Building and maintaining forecasts that give ownership visibility into cash position weeks and months ahead, not just after the fact 
  • Budgeting and variance analysis: Creating a working budget, tracking performance against it monthly, and using the variance to drive accountability and early course correction 
  • Custom financial reporting: Building reporting around the metrics that actually matter for your specific business rather than default output from accounting software 
  • KPI development and tracking: Identifying and consistently reporting on the handful of numbers that have the most direct impact on profitability and growth 
  • Lender and banking relationships: Ensuring your financials are clean, current, and tell the right story when you need to access credit or work with a financing partner

Is It Worth It?

For most growing businesses that have reached the point where financial complexity is outpacing their current setup, the answer is yes. The value shows up in concrete, specific ways. 

Decisions Get Made With Better Information

One of the most consistent outcomes of bringing in a fractional CFO is that ownership stops making major financial decisions on instinct. Hiring, expansion, taking on debt, entering a new market. When those decisions are backed by a current forecast and a senior financial voice in the room, the quality improves and the risk of costly mistakes drops significantly. 

Cash Flow Becomes Predictable

Unpredictable cash flow is one of the most common and most avoidable problems growing businesses face. A fractional CFO builds the forecasting processes that give ownership visibility weeks and months ahead rather than reacting to shortfalls after the fact. The cost of one avoided cash flow crisis will often cover an entire year of fractional CFO fees. Understanding how cash flow projection works is part of what makes this possible. 

Ownership Gets Time Back

When the founder or CEO is acting as the financial officer, something important is always getting less attention than it deserves. A fractional CFO frees ownership to focus on leading the business rather than managing the numbers.
